    Are you using the cutter for general fabrication or plans for a CNC plasma table?

    If you are only doing random, short cuts, a big compressor is not required. If you want to run a table, like said above, a 60 gallon with at least 10 cfm output is pretty standard.

    It's one of those things that once you have it, you will find reasons to use it much more frequently than you expect.

    If it's not something that has to be cut in place, I'd just use sendcutsend.

    If it's an issue with a cheap plasma cutter being $200 but a cheap large compressor being close to $1000, I've run my plasma off of my power tank once or twice when I was welding/cutting with my generator and couldn't bring a giant compressor. Could be a good excuse to get. CO2 tank from a welding shop and a regulator from online.
